Fortifying Your Defenses: Mitigating Layer 4 Attacks
Layer 4 attacks target the transport layer of the network protocol stack, violating network communication protocols like TCP and UDP. These attacks often aim to overload network resources, causing service disruptions and hindering legitimate traffic flow. To effectively defend against these threats, organizations must implement a multi-layered approach that includes advanced firewalls, intrusion detection systems (IDS), and rate limiting measures.
It's crucial to analyze network traffic patterns closely and detect any anomalies indicative of Layer 4 attacks. Implementing configurable security policies that allow for specific control over inbound and outbound traffic is essential. Regular audits of your network infrastructure can help identify vulnerabilities and ensure your defenses are up to date.
Remember, a comprehensive and proactive approach to security is key to effectively protecting your network against Layer check here 4 attacks.
Sophisticated Network Warfare: Mastering Layer 7 DDoS Techniques
In the ever-evolving landscape of cybersecurity, attackers continuously refines their strategies to exploit vulnerabilities and disrupt critical infrastructure. One particularly insidious tactic gaining traction is Layer 7 Distributed Denial of Service (DDoS) attacks. These attacks aim at application layers, exploiting specific protocols and services to overwhelm systems with malicious traffic. Unlike traditional DDoS attacks that flood network infrastructure, Layer 7 attacks maliciously craft payloads that resemble legitimate requests, making them harder to identify. This creates a significant challenge for defenders who must implement robust security measures to mitigate these sophisticated threats.
